编译内核操作流程 ──为新手指南
Firefox 中文乱码

ubuntu 8.10 LaTex + 中文字体

simplyzhao posted @ 2009年2月26日 06:41 in GNU/Linux with tags latex 中文字体 , 3256 阅读

今天刚在机器上安装好LaTex以及中文字体,毕业论文即将开始,不知道用不用的上呵呵呵

参考的文章是:blog.upsuper.org.cn/ubuntu-trip-7-latex-return/

首先是到这里下载最新的TexLive的iso文件,文件很大(1.2G左右),我是在Windows下用迅雷下载的,速度很快,这里以texlive2008-20080822.iso.lzma为例。


unlzma texlive2008-20080822.iso.lzma

sudo mkdir /media/texlive
sudo mount -o loop  texlive2008-20080822.iso /media/texlive
cd /media/texlive
sudo ./install-tl
 

然后按"I"开始安装。安装过程是全自动化的。

另外,具体安装过程也可以参考 www.tug.org/texlive/quickinstall.html

特别注意:

you must add the TeX Live binary directory to your PATH:
  PATH=/usr/local/texlive/2008/bin/i386-linux:/usr/local/texlive/2008/bin/i386-linux: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/Adobe/Adobe/Reader8/bin:/usr/local/emelfm2/bin

编辑/etc/environment,在PATH的最前面加上“/usr/local/texlive/2008/bin/i386-linux:”


中文字体支持

首先字体文件可以在Windows系统的C:/Windows/Fonts文件夹下找到,例如simhei.ttf, simkai.ttf等。

主要使用的是一个脚本文件: mkfont.tar.gz

./mkfont.sh simkai.ttf simkai kai

./mkfont.sh simsun.ttf simsun song

.........类似,注意宋体必须要用Windows 98所带的宋体,不然不支持

最后找到主文件夹下有一个“texmf”文件夹,将里面的东西拷贝到“~/.texlive2007/texmf-var”文件夹下即可。

simhei.ttf ---> hei (黑体)

simsun.ttf ---> song (宋体)

simkai.ttf ---> kai (楷体)

simfang.ttf ---> fang (仿宋)

SIMLI.TTF ---> li (隶书)

SIMYOU.TTF ---> you (幼圆)

以上是我转换成功的字体,测试:

\documentclass{article}
\usepackage{CJKutf8}
\begin{document}
\begin{CJK*}{UTF8}{song}
你好!
\end{CJK*}
\begin{CJK*}{UTF8}{kai}
你好!
\end{CJK*}
\begin{CJK*}{UTF8}{hei}
你好!
\end{CJK*}
\begin{CJK*}{UTF8}{fang}
你好!
\end{CJK*}
\end{document}

 

Enjoy Linux, Fighting.

登录 *


loading captcha image...
(输入验证码)
or Ctrl+Enter